There are different types of motor insurance coverage options. The minimum coverage can be low in some products while it can be the highest in other insurance products. There are minimum requirements that each and every state has. These requirements should be enough to cover the injured parties or you in case of an accident. If you are found liable then you should be able to bear the loss. However, if you are the victim the other party has to bear the loss.
The car accident insurance comes with different packages. These packages come with different levels of coverage options. A minimum amount of insurance is a must; however, purchasing just a minimum is always risky. This is because the minimum coverage might not help you in a great way if the accident is severe. There are variety of options such as liability insurance, collision insurance, comprehensive insurance, medical, no-fault insurance, personal injury protection, supplemental insurance, underinsured coverage, uninsured coverage and the like.
